The Sunshine Vitamin and Its Health Benefits
What is the Sunshine Vitamin? The sunshine vitamin, commonly known as vitamin D, is a fat-soluble nutrient that plays a crucial role in numerous physiological processes in the human body. Unlike other vitamins, vitamin D can be synthesized by the body when the skin is exposed to sunlight, specifically ultraviolet B (UVB) rays. This unique trait makes it one of the most easily accessible nutrients, provided adequate sun exposure. However, many individuals experience deficiencies due to lifestyle factors, geographical location, or limited sun exposure.
